UNIABUJA Postgraduate Admission Form 2026/2027. The University of Abuja (UNIABUJA) has opened applications for admission into its postgraduate programmes for the 2026/2027 academic session. The programmes include Postgraduate Diploma (PGD), academic and professional master’s degrees, MPhil and PhD programmes across several faculties and disciplines.

Applications will close on Wednesday, 30 September 2026.
How to Apply for UNIABUJA Postgraduate Admission 2026/2027
Applicants are required to complete the application online through the University of Abuja postgraduate application portal.
Follow these steps to apply:
- Open the UNIABUJA postgraduate application portal.
- Begin the online application and provide the required personal and academic information.
- Generate the application fee of ₦20,500.
- Pay the non-refundable fee through REMITA on the postgraduate application portal.
- Complete the remaining sections of the application form.
- Process your academic transcript using the required Transcript Request Form, Form A2.
- Submit the completed application before the 30 September 2026 deadline.
Applicants should confirm that they meet the admission requirements for their chosen programme before paying the application fee.

UNIABUJA Postgraduate Admission Requirements
Admission requirements depend on the programme and level of study. Applicants must satisfy the general postgraduate requirements as well as any additional conditions attached to their chosen programme.
What Are the General O’Level Requirements?
Applicants must possess at least five relevant O’Level credit passes, including:
- English Language
- Mathematics
Accepted examinations include:
- WAEC
- NECO
- GCE
- NABTEB
The five credits must be obtained in no more than two sittings.
Is an NYSC Certificate Required?
Yes. Prospective applicants must provide evidence of completing the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) programme.
A certificate of exemption or exclusion will also be accepted where applicable.
What Are the Requirements for a Postgraduate Diploma?
Applicants for PGD programmes must possess either:
- A university degree with at least Third Class, or
- A Higher National Diploma (HND) with at least Lower Credit.
Some departments have higher or additional requirements, so applicants should check the conditions for their chosen programme.
What Are the Requirements for a Master’s Degree?
Applicants for MSc, MA, MEd and other academic master’s programmes must generally possess a relevant bachelor’s degree with at least Second Class Honours, Lower Division.
Some programmes have additional requirements. For example, Financial Economics requires a minimum CGPA of 3.00.
Professional and health-related master’s programmes may also require specific degrees, professional registration or relevant clinical experience.
What Are the Requirements for a PhD?
PhD applicants must possess a relevant master’s degree with either:
- A minimum weighted average score of 60 per cent (Grade B), or
- A minimum CGPA of 3.50.
Each PhD applicant must also submit a research proposal of at least 500 words.
Individual departments may have additional academic or professional requirements.
What Are the Requirements for Professional and Health-Related Programmes?
Professional and health-related programmes require qualifications relevant to the proposed field.
For example, some public health programmes may require an MBBS, BDS or another specified professional degree. Some programmes may also require clinical experience or valid registration with a relevant professional body.
Applicants should carefully check the requirements for their selected programme.

Animal Science PhD Requirements
PhD Animal Science applicants must possess five O’Level credits in:
- Mathematics
- English Language
- Biology or Agricultural Science
- Chemistry
- Geography or Economics
A pass in Physics is also required.
Applicants must also have a weighted average of at least 60 per cent or a CGPA of 3.50 in an MSc Animal Science programme from the University of Abuja or another recognised university.
Applicants must also demonstrate satisfactory potential for research.
Duration of the Animal Science PhD
The PhD Animal Science programme is full-time.
- Minimum: Three sessions or six semesters
- Maximum: Five sessions or 10 semesters
Animal Science Master’s Requirements
Applicants must possess five O’Level credits in:
- Mathematics
- English Language
- Biology or Agricultural Science
- Chemistry
- Geography or Economics
Accepted first degrees include:
- BTech Animal Science or Production
- BAgric Animal Production
- BAgric Animal Science
- BAgric Animal Production and Health
The degree must be approved by the Nigerian Institute of Animal Science.
Applicants must also satisfy one of the following:
- A minimum Second Class bachelor’s degree in Animal Science from the University of Abuja
- A B Agric degree in Animal Science, Animal Production or Animal Production and Health from a recognised university
- A Third Class degree in Animal Science with at least five years of relevant post-qualification experience
- A Third Class degree in Animal Science with a Postgraduate Diploma in Animal Science, Animal Production or Animal Production and Health from a recognised university
Duration of the Animal Science MSc
The MSc Animal Science programme combines coursework and research and is full-time.
- Minimum: Two sessions or four semesters
- Maximum: Three sessions or six semesters
Animal Science PGD Requirements
Applicants must have five O’Level credits in:
- Mathematics
- English Language
- Biology or Agricultural Science
- Chemistry
- Geography or Economics
A pass in Physics is also required.
Applicants must possess either:
- An HND in Animal Science with at least Upper Credit, or
- A bachelor’s degree in Animal Science with at least Third Class.
The qualification must be obtained from a recognised institution.
Duration of the Animal Science PGD
The PGD Animal Science programme is full-time.
- Minimum: One session or two semesters
- Maximum: Two sessions or four semesters

Basic Requirements for PhD Clinical Sciences
Applicants must possess five O’Level credit passes in:
- Biology
- Chemistry
- Physics
- English Language
- Mathematics
The credits may be obtained through WAEC, NECO, GCE or NABTEB.
Applicants must also possess either:
- Part I membership of NPMCN, WACP, WAC or NECS, or
- An MSc with an overall grade of at least 60 per cent in a relevant course.
PGD Complementary and Alternative Medicine Requirements
Applicants must possess five O’Level credit passes in:
- Biology
- Chemistry
- Physics
- English Language
- Mathematics
They must also possess an MBBS, BDS or relevant BSc qualification, such as:
- Pharmacy
- Nursing Science
- Medical Laboratory Science
- Physiotherapy
